[mythtv-users] building mythtv from source on Debian 11 Bullseye/Linux Mint Debian Edition

Bill keemllib at gmail.com
Wed Jul 13 15:14:05 UTC 2022


On 7/13/22 05:43, James Abernathy wrote:
> 
> 
> On Tue, Jul 12, 2022 at 10:23 PM Bill <keemllib at gmail.com <mailto:keemllib at gmail.com>> wrote:
> 
>     On 7/12/22 10:22, James Abernathy wrote:
>      >
>      >
>      > On Tue, Jul 12, 2022 at 10:38 AM Bill <keemllib at gmail.com <mailto:keemllib at gmail.com> <mailto:keemllib at gmail.com <mailto:keemllib at gmail.com>>> wrote:
>      >
>      >     On 7/11/22 14:46, James Abernathy wrote:
>      >      > On LMDE5 I had some errors.  One thing I was not prepared for was the question, "BECOME password"  I just entered my user password and it continued.
>      >      >
>      >
>      >     That's the right choice, it's the same password used to sudo.
>      >
>      >     Behind the scenes, Ansible is doing running as root. The original MythTV Ansible is run as: sudo ansible-playbook -i hosts qt5.yml.
>      >
>      >     --
>      >     Bill
>      >
>      >
>      > I just built 2 VM systems:
>      >
>      > 1. LMDE5 where I used your patched ansible playbook and it got all the dependencies as the non-ansible list.  I built mythtv and tested the backend and frontend but without the XMLTV grabbers.  I just used OTA EPG via the EIT Video source. Everything seemed to work correctly, but it wasn't an extensive test. I did have some issues on the first run of mythtv-setup.  It wanted to upgrade my database to a new schema and got a segment fault the first few times I ran it. I rebooted and finally got past that point and then I could run setup to completion.
>      >
>      > 2.  on Debian Testing (Bookworm), I previously reported that the patched ansible fails, but I ran sudo apt install on the non-ansible list of dependencies and 1 failed.  python3-oauth is not available for Bookworm. I tried python3-oauthlib as a replacement and it installed. I then built mythtv the same as in #1 and it worked as expected without any need to upgrade the database.
>      >
>      > Jim A
> 
>     Just pushed a new version, using information from: https://www.debian.org/releases <https://www.debian.org/releases>, 10=Buster, 11=Bullseye, 12=testing (will be Bookworm).
>     There were lower case tests for 'bookworm' that I changed t 'testing'.
> 
>     Please try again, libcrystalhd-dev should be gone now.
> 
>     -- 
>     Bill
> 
> 
> Will I be testing with the development pull or the standard released playbook?
> 
> JIm A

The devel/2022 branch please. And, I just pushed the python3-oauth' -> 'python3-oauthlib' change.

-- 
Bill


More information about the mythtv-users mailing list